Emmvee Group Starts Photovoltaic Project Development
Emmvee, manufacturer of photovoltaic modules, has embarked on new business activities.
The units project management and EPC contracting are the new assets besides the established pillars, solar-thermal and photovoltaic as well as toughening glass.

Project Development and EPC Contractor:
The new business units are to develop turn key projects, plan and implement solar installations of size. From the planning stages to the maintenance of existing solar parks.
First projects are already in the making. In two German cities, two big installations are in the finishing stages or have just begun:
In Doberschütz, Emmvee have installed the biggest roof installation with structured glass in Germany and in Bronkow, a defunct military airport is to be transformed into a solar park with almost 12 MW. Emmvee has financed and implemented all works on the projects by itself.
The new business unit consists of engineering, procurement and construction as well as maintenance. Emmvee have gained some 20 years of experience in the solar field and relies on a team with an international expertise in order to execute projects successfully.
“Emmvee uses high quality components in its modules and also the solar systems will be a combination of the best products available, from our modules to inverters, everything will work together since we have gained years of experience,” says Steffen Graf, CEO of Emmvee Photovoltaics GmbH in Berlin.
D.V. Manjunatha, founder and Managing Director of Emmvee, adds: “We now have new pillars to place our business activities upon in order to generate further business growth in Europe and India: next to photovoltaic modules, solar-thermal appliances and toughening glass, the project development will be a prominent part of our business.”
